The Commodity Futures Trading Commission’s Divisions of Market Oversight, Clearing and Risk, and Market Participants issued a request for comment to inform its approach to perpetual contracts in the derivatives markets it regulates, focusing on potential uses, benefits, and risks. The request covers the characteristics of perpetual derivatives, including how features may vary across products, and the implications for trading, clearing, and risk management. It also seeks input on risks to market integrity and customer protection, including issues relevant to retail trading. Comments are due by May 21 and can be submitted through the CFTC’s online comments process.
